Statistics was classified in terms of two phases namely Theoretical and Applied Statistics. Theoretical statistics, also called as mathematical statistics, mainly involves the derivation of statistical theorems, development of standard formulas, rules and laws to be used for solving many realworld problems. Applied mathematics is the application of mathematical methods by different fields such as science, engineering, business, computer science, and industry. Applied mathematics has substantial overlap with the discipline of statistics. Applied mathematics uses mathematics to solve problems that come from the sciences, engineering, computer science, business, and industry. While the motivation is often to solve particular problems, the theory developed can be of wideranging interest.
